About The Position

The Data Engineer & Governance Specialist works closely with the Technical Project Manager, data governance specialists, epidemiologists, research psychologists, tactical sports scientists, data scientists, and software teams to translate analytic and research requirements into scalable data solutions under Government direction. This role does not set independent data policies or analytic strategies but will enable the Government’s decision making through the facilitation of working. Responsibilities

  • Data ingestion, transformation, and integration
  • Creation of data pipelines and data services
  • Enablement of analytics, AI/ML, and reporting workflows
  • Integration of scientific and operational data sources
  • Interact with Data Steward responsible for H2FMS systems
  • Follow the Data Governance framework established by the office
  • Design, develop, and maintain data ingestion and transformation pipelines supporting H2FMS analytics and research use cases.
  • Integrate data from multiple sources, including surveys, wearable and performance data, health and injury datasets, and operational systems as directed by the H2FMS Government Lead.
  • Ensure pipelines are reliable, scalable, and support downstream analytic and reporting needs.
  • Support development of analytic data models optimized for dashboarding/reporting and statistical learning using the Army Vantage reporting system.
  • Work with data governance staff to ensure data models align with approved data definitions and standards.
  • Assist with management of structured, semi-structured, and unstructured data used within H2FMS.
  • Serve as a designated Data Custodian for assigned data domains, owning the accuracy and completeness of data asset inventories, classifications, and ownership records.
  • Execute data governance policies, standards, and procedures established by the Enterprise Data Governance team, applying independent judgment to implement guidelines within the program or business unit context.
  • Lead the intake and registration of new data sources into the enterprise data catalog, ensuring metadata, data definitions, and lineage are documented prior to use in analytics or reporting.
  • Actively participate in Enterprise Data Governance working groups as a domain representative, contributing engineering and program-level perspective to policy discussions.
  • Support periodic governance assessments and audits, leading the collection and preparation of evidence and documentation on behalf of the program or business unit.
  • Own the data quality monitoring program for assigned data domains, overseeing coverage across key quality dimensions including completeness, accuracy, consistency, timeliness, uniqueness, and validity.
  • Own and maintain end-to-end metadata records, data dictionaries, and data lineage documentation for assigned data assets from source systems through transformation pipelines to analytic and reporting outputs.
  • Enable data access and preparation for data scientists, AI/ML engineers , and other data professionals, ensuring data is usable for modeling and analysis.
  • Support feature preparation and data validation activities under Government and senior analytic direction.
  • Assist in troubleshooting data-related issues impacting analytics and model development.
  • Support monitoring and resolution of data quality issues , including completeness, consistency, and timeliness.
  • Implement basic validation, logging, and error-handling mechanisms within data pipelines.
  • Coordinate with data governance and analytics teams to address recurring data issues.
